]> git.eshelyaron.com Git - emacs.git/commit
Simplify 'completion-preview-active-mode' command tagging
authorEshel Yaron <me@eshelyaron.com>
Wed, 26 Feb 2025 19:11:20 +0000 (20:11 +0100)
committerEshel Yaron <me@eshelyaron.com>
Wed, 26 Feb 2025 19:11:20 +0000 (20:11 +0100)
commite2258effbf7f9cd008844f27c87e3809eea076dd
treeb2ce54600084ca01a459862dbcafc3360b1bea03
parent796771b588e88c1e12f1792d6c884f26bc4597da
Simplify 'completion-preview-active-mode' command tagging

* lisp/completion-preview.el (completion-preview-insert)
(completion-preview-insert-word)
(completion-preview-insert-sexp)
(completion-preview-complete)
(completion-preview-prev-candidate)
(completion-preview-next-candidate): Use 'interactive' to
associate command with 'completion-preview-active-mode'
instead of using a bespoke 'completion-predicate' property.
(completion-preview-active-p): Declare obsolete.
lisp/completion-preview.el